Hong Loan : Clear statement is fine.

Right after the sharing of Hong Phuong - granddaughter of Meritorious Artist Vu Linh related to the noise between family members, Hong Loan - daughter of Meritorious Artist Vu Linh also had the latest move.

On her personal page, Hong Loan wrote briefly: "A clear statement is enough, other things are not necessary."

Meanwhile, artist Binh Tinh - one of the adopted children of the late Meritorious Artist Vu Linh did not mention the family's turmoil.

She shared a photo of her adoptive father with the message: "Dad, you are always beautiful, forever beautiful in the hearts of our beloved audience. And only you, for no reason can you be ugly."

Previously, on the afternoon of June 16, singer Hong Phuong officially appeared before the media to speak out about the controversy between family members after Meritorious Artist Vu Linh passed away.

Hong Phuong confided that she felt heartbroken having to sit here and clarify every donation and expenditure at the funeral of Meritorious Artist Vu Linh.

According to Hong Phuong, the total amount collected was more than 1 billion VND. Of which, the condolence money was more than 576 million VND, the money received after the funeral (before 49 days) was 149 million 740,000 VND and the money received for building the tomb was 277 million 400 thousand VND. Of which, the amount spent during the funeral was 610 million 950 thousand VND. The amount spent after the funeral (before 49 days) was 81 million 950 thousand VND and the cost of building the tomb was 325 million VND.

Vu Linh's niece confirmed that all expenses for the funeral were informed to the whole family and Hong Loan beforehand.

"I affirm that everyone knows how much money was spent. On the third day of his death, everyone in the family decided to go into his room to open his cabinet to check. We found a box containing 4,100 USD. Everyone saw this amount. Then an artist sent another 100 USD, so it added up to 4,200 USD. This amount was put into the funeral money to take care of him later.

Regarding the reason why my mother and I kept the money, at that time, Hong Loan was not at Vu Linh's house. Therefore, we kept it to pay for the funeral expenses. This was agreed by Hong Loan. The entire amount of money was recorded in the book, I also showed it to Hong Loan," she said.

Hong Phuong affirmed that she did not know that there was 13,000 USD in Meritorious Artist Vu Linh's wardrobe, this was said by Hong Loan.

Hong Loan did not know that she took the money to fix the car and pay for the expenses. If Loan had not told her, she and her family would not have known that there was 13,000 USD.

"I still remember one time my mother showed Hong Loan the income and expenditure book. However, at that time, Loan was the one who looked at it and said: "I don't understand anything". I think it was because she didn't understand that Loan said she didn't know", she affirmed.

In addition, Hong Phuong also denied the rumor that she recently bought a luxury car worth 800 million VND as many sources of information are spreading.

Hong Phuong: I will submit a petition for help.

Regarding the inheritance dispute over artist Vu Linh’s assets, Hong Phuong said she was not the one filing the lawsuit. However, as a person with related rights, the female singer will appear in court to provide documents and evidence.

"I stopped my mother from filing a lawsuit. I told her that I had studied the law and that we would not be able to win. After that, I advised my mother many times to withdraw the lawsuit but she did not. I think the reason my mother continued to file a lawsuit was because of her feelings, emotions, frustration and anger towards Hong Loan. She could not resolve the matter within the family, so she asked the law to handle it."

Regarding the content of the oral will mentioned in Ms. Nhung's lawsuit, Hong Phuong said that the clips she recorded while artist Vu Linh was still alive were all accidental, "memories and love for him, with no legal value". She herself did not think that one day the family members would sue over property disputes.

According to Hong Phuong, the family conflict reached its peak when Hong Loan asked her and her mother to leave the house at 5 Doan Thi Diem (Phu Nhuan). At the same time, Hong Loan also did not allow Ms. Nga - who had taken care of Vu Linh for many years, to live in the house.

After the incident, Hong Phuong and her mother had to stay at someone else's house. She said her whole family was homeless.

Hong Phuong added that in the near future, she will submit a petition for help to the authorities. She confided: “I have an elderly mother and a young child. I am living in a state of homelessness, moving from one place to another. I cannot take my clothes or belongings. I hope that the authorities will consider whether my family has to leave the house or not. Suddenly, when my uncle passed away, everything changed. That is what makes me heartbroken.”

The singer said that after the scandal broke out, her work and spirit were affected. She herself fell into crisis because she was attacked from many sides.

Many partners also canceled their cooperation with the female singer. Hong Phuong's income was seriously affected, not ensuring enough financial resources to cover living expenses, support her elderly mother and young children.

"I hope to return to art with the name Hong Phuong, niece of Meritorious Artist Vu Linh. It is a pride that he was still alive until now he passed away...", the female singer confided.
